Banks make money by using the money that others deposit with the bank (it’s more complicated than that, but that’s the ELI5 gist). If no one puts their money in a bank, the bank has no money to use to make itself money.

Let’s say there are 2 banks in town. One pays no interest to depositors, while the other pays 5% interest. Which one are you depositing your money with? That’s the only reason banks pay interest – to entice you and others to deposit their money with them.
